2637  Alternate cryptocurrencies / Altcoin Discussion / Re: Secret Crypto Club?? on: November 23, 2017, 03:03:46 AM
There is a secret crypto club. They say what to buy and what gains you are likely to make. Insider info somehow. I don't know what it is based on.
There are Telegram based groups that give signals on what to Buy and when to Sell but their operations is suspicious and for me its not to serve their members but to serve themselves by Buying early and give signals to their members to Buy and that pumps the price further then the operator will start dumping. I don't recommend joining those groups.

Other than that, there are whales and they have a lot of money to spend, that money can be their personal money or money pooled from different sources and they have enough funds manipulate the price of a coin to make it look like theres a demand so other traders will Buy, then whales will start Selling or dumping.

2639  Economy / Trading Discussion / Re: Trading Deposits on: November 21, 2017, 09:59:47 AM
I'm new to trading cryptos and I just want to ask any members here who use to trade in any online brokerage how much deposits thus your online broker  asks you before you can start trading cryptos.

Any online broker will do. Just needed a list for future reference. Huh

Thanks in advance!
Create an account first at Bittrex, Poloniex, Binance or Cryptopia and deposit at least 0.005BTC and you are good to go. You can start trading with that amount of BTC. For every trade that you make there will be fees to added or deducted. I think the fees in Poloniex is smaller compared to Bittrex but trade volume and pairs is bigger in Bittrex.
